AM Best Places Credit Ratings of Pacific International Insurance Pty Limited Under Review With Developing Implications

Singapore //BestWire// - AM Best has placed under review with developing implications the Financial Strength Rating of B++ (Good) and the Long-Term Issuer Credit Rating of “bbb” of Pacific International Insurance Pty Limited (Pacific) (Australia).

These Credit Rating (rating) actions follow Pacific informing AM Best of a forthcoming material change to its business plans and scope of operations over the near term. Historically, Pacific has operated as a small and niche insurer underwriting principally liability products for the pest control and building inspection industries in Australia and New Zealand. However, with effect from July 2019, Pacific is expected to commence underwriting a sizeable portfolio of existing motor business in Australia, arising from affiliated underwriting agencies, which also are held by Badger International (NZ) LP. This motor business was written previously by a third-party insurer but going forward, at point of renewal, will be underwritten by Pacific. This strategic change, coupled with Pacific’s wider intentions to grow its new product offerings in Australia and New Zealand rapidly, are likely to result in a material change to the company’s operations over the near term.

The ratings have been placed under review with developing implications while AM Best conducts a full assessment on these strategic changes and considers the impact on Pacific’s prospective rating fundamentals. AM Best will seek to hold further discussions with the company regarding these changes, as well as obtain and review revised business plans and financial forecasts. Among other factors, AM Best will need to assess the impact of forecast business growth on the company’s prospective risk-adjusted capitalization and underwriting performance. Execution risk arising from the revised business strategy and expansion plans also will be considered.

AM Best expects to resolve the under review status following the conclusion of its assessment.
